WebApr 1, 2016 · Assessing students' entry-level knowledge and skills at the start of a new unit or course also provides baseline data from which teachers can gauge improvements in learning. More formally, pre-assessment results may be used to calculate gain scores in value-added models of accountability or to monitor progress for instructional … WebApr 17, 2024 · Three types of online quizzes are convenient ways to assess prior knowledge before class: Open response – Ask students to define or explain specific concepts. An advantage is that you can zero in on the specific prior knowledge you think is most relevant. A potential disadvantage is the amount of time to read and analyze the answers.
